Key Responsibilities

  • •Support the Social Responsibility, Inclusion & Communities (SRI&C) team with planning, coordination, and execution of CSR and inclusion programs
  • •Create and prepare communications (PowerPoint presentations, newsletters, draft messages, summaries, and talking points) for internal and external audiences
  • •Conduct research and gather input for projects related to social responsibility, employee engagement, and nonprofit partnerships
  • •Maintain editorial calendars, event plans, and project documentation
  • •Coordinate meetings, track deadlines, and support day-to-day project management and stakeholder alignment
Travel: Low travel

Key Requirements

  • •Be enrolled as a student (f/m/d) at a university or a university of applied sciences
  • •Preferred fields of study include Communications, Business Administration, Social Sciences, Organizational Psychology, Marketing, or related areas
  • •Fluent in English and German
  • •Strong computer skills with PowerPoint, Excel, and Word (SharePoint experience is a plus)
  • •First experience in communications, event support, project coordination, or the nonprofit sector is beneficial (but not required)
